Bol Bachchan (2012) – Movie Report Bol Bachchan is a 2012 Bollywood action-comedy directed by Rohit Shetty. Inspired by the 1979 classic Gol Maal, it follows Abbas Ali (Abhishek Bachchan), who moves to Ranakpur after losing his property. To escape trouble after breaking into a temple to save a child, Abbas lies to the village strongman, Prithviraj Raghuvanshi (Ajay Devgn), by using a fake Hindu name. This single lie spirals into a web of hilarious deceptions, including the invention of a fictional "effeminate" twin brother. Quick Facts
